Blog

Startup Yazılımı ile Pazara Hızlı Girmenin En Etkili Yöntemleri

Bir startup’ın pazara hızlı girmesi, rekabetin yoğunlaştığı dijital ekosistemde kritik bir başarı faktörüdür. Doğru teknik mimari, yalın operasyon akışları ve güvenlik standartlarıyla desteklenen bir yazılım yaklaşımı, ilk günden itibaren hem çevikliği hem de güvenilirliği sağlar. Bu makalede, hızlı ürün geliştirme, MVP optimizasyonu, modern entegrasyon mimarileri, performans ve güvenlik stratejileri gibi pek çok alanda eyleme dönük yöntemlere odaklanıyoruz.

Neden Hızlı Pazara Giriş?

Startup dünyasında hız, sadece avantaj değil; çoğu zaman hayatta kalma koşuludur. Yeni bir yazılım ürününün pazara girme sürecinin kısaltılması, geri bildirim döngülerinin hızlanmasını, kaynak kullanımının optimize edilmesini ve rakiplerden önce konumlanmayı sağlar. Bu nedenle geliştirilecek sistemin, ölçeklenebilir, modüler ve güvenli bir temele sahip olması gerekir.

Stratejik Değer: MVP’den Sürdürülebilir Platforma

Hızlı bir başlangıç, uzun vadeli teknik borç üretmemelidir. MVP (Minimum Viable Product) yalnızca temel özellikleri sunmakla kalmamalı, büyüyebilir bir mimarinin de ön izlemesini oluşturmalıdır. Bunu sağlamak için aşağıdaki stratejiler uygulanabilir:

  • Fonksiyonları bağımsız modüller halinde tasarlamak
  • Kritik olmayan bileşenleri üçüncü taraf SaaS servisleriyle başlatmak
  • Veri modellerini gelecekteki genişlemelere açık kurgulamak
  • İzlenebilirlik ve performans ölçüm altyapısını MVP aşamasından itibaren kurmak

Modern Yazılım Mimarileri ile Hızlı Adaptasyon

Pazara hızlı giriş için doğru mimariler büyük avantaj sağlar. Aşağıdaki modern yaklaşımlar startup ekosistemlerinde güçlü karşılık bulur.

API Odaklı Gelişim: REST, GraphQL ve gRPC

API-first yaklaşımı sayesinde frontend, mobil ve üçüncü taraf servislerin entegrasyonu oldukça kolaylaşır. Hızlı pazara giriş için:

  • REST API ile geniş ekosistem desteği
  • GraphQL ile esnek veri sorguları ve düşük over-fetching
  • gRPC ile yüksek performanslı mikroservis iletişimi

iPaaS / ESB Entegrasyonları

Özellikle büyüme aşamalarında şirket içi ve dışı veri akışlarının standartlaştırılması şarttır. iPaaS platformları hızlı entegrasyon sağlar; ESB yapıları ise kural bazlı yönetişim sunar.

  • CRM, ERP, ödeme servisleri gibi sistemlerle düşük kodlu entegrasyon kabiliyeti
  • Gerçek zamanlı akış ile siparişten tahsilata O2C sürecini hızlandırma
  • Veri uyum katmanı üzerinden PII maskeleme

ETL/ELT Süreçleri: Veri Hazırlığına Hız Katmak

Startup’ların büyümesiyle veri miktarı ve veri işleme ihtiyacı da artar. ETL/ELT modelleri düzenli veri akışlarını hızlandırır.

  • ELT ile ham veriyi veri ambarına aktarıp dönüşümü orada gerçekleştirme
  • Modern araçlarla (dbt, Airbyte) esnek veri pipelines yönetimi
  • S&OP/MRP raporlamaları için veri modelleme

Event-Driven Mimariler

Gerçek zamanlı bildirimler, sipariş akışları, kullanıcı aktiviteleri gibi süreçlerde event-driven yaklaşım yüksek hız sağlar.

  • Kafka veya AWS SNS/SQS ile olay kuyrukları
  • Event sourcing sayesinde geriye dönük veri izlenebilirliği
  • Dağıtık sistemlerde düşük gecikme (low-latency) operasyonlar

Güvenlik ve Uyum: Hızlı Ama Güvenli

Hızın güvenlikten ödün vermesi asla kabul edilebilir değildir. MVP aşamasında bile temel güvenlik katmanlarının uygulanması zorunludur.

  • Kimlik doğrulama: OAuth 2.0, OpenID Connect
  • Erişim yetkisi: RBAC veya ABAC politikaları
  • MFA zorunlulukları
  • PII maskeleme ve veri minimizasyonu
  • Şifreleme: TLS 1.3, veri-at-rest AES-256

Uyum (Compliance)

Hızlı büyüyen startup’lar çoğu zaman düzenlemelere uyumu sonradan düşünür. Ancak erken aşamada aşağıdaki yapıların oluşturulması kritik önem taşır:

  • GDPR uyumlu veri işleme süreçleri
  • Loglama ve olay yönetimi (SIEM) altyapısı
  • Denetim izi (audit log) oluşturma

Performans ve Gözlemlenebilirlik

Hızlı pazara giriş, hızlı ve stabil performans anlamına gelmelidir. Kullanıcı deneyimini etkileyen temel metrikleri MVP'den itibaren takip etmek gerekir.

  • TTFB (Time to First Byte)
  • TTI (Time to Interactive)
  • API latency
  • Concurrency ölçümleri

Gözlemlenebilirlik Bileşenleri

  • Centralized logging (Elastic, Loki)
  • Distributed tracing (Jaeger, Zipkin)
  • Metrics & alerting (Prometheus, Grafana)

Gerçek Senaryolar: Hızlı Pazar Başlangıcının Pratik Örnekleri

Aşağıdaki senaryolar startup yazılımlarında erken aşama kazanımlar sağlayabilir:

  • MVP’de ödeme doğrulama için tam entegrasyon yerine webhooks kullanmak
  • Makine öğrenmesi yerine kural bazlı basit öneri motoru ile başlamak
  • İş akışını BPMN motoru ile değil serverless fonksiyonlarla yönetmek

KPI ve ROI: Başarıyı Ölçmek

Hızlı pazara girişi ölçülebilir hale getirmek için spesifik KPI’ların tanımlanması gerekir. Örneğin:

  • Kullanıcı edinme maliyeti
  • İlk değere ulaşma süresi (Time-to-Value)
  • Bırakma oranı (churn)
  • Altyapı maliyet/performans oranı

En İyi Uygulamalar

  • Modüler mimari ile geleceğe hazırlık
  • CI/CD kullanarak hızlı ve güvenilir dağıtım
  • Infrastructure as Code (Terraform) kullanmak
  • Feature flags ile risksiz canlıya alma
  • Stateless servis tasarımıyla ölçeklenebilirlik

Kontrol Listesi

  • MVP özellik seti tanımlandı mı?
  • API-first mimari uygulandı mı?
  • Monitoring ve alerting aktif mi?
  • RBAC/ABAC yetkilendirme kurgulandı mı?
  • Ölçek testleri tamamlandı mı?

Startup yazılımı ile pazara hızlı giriş, yalnızca “hız” odaklı değil; sürdürülebilir, güvenli ve ölçeklenebilir temeller üzerinde inşa edildiğinde gerçek anlamda değer üretir. Doğru mimari, doğru ölçümleme, doğru güvenlik katmanı ve doğru operasyon tasarımı bir araya geldiğinde hız, startup’ın en güçlü rekabet avantajına dönüşür.